The family of David R. Collins of Simpsonville, SC mourn his passing. On July 23rd, 2010 at the age of 63 years, the beloved husband, father, and grandfather succumbed to cancer only two short weeks after his diagnosis. David passed gracefully and peacefully from the McCall Hospice House in Simpsonville, SC.
A graduate of High Point University, NC David worked for the E. I. DuPont/Sterling/Agfa Company for 30 years in the medical x-ray division in Chicago (later in Greenville) and recently for Aflac Insurance.
David is survived by his wife Barbara, of 42 years; his two children Bonnie Marciante (and her husband John) of Rochester, NY and Richard Collins (and his wife Loreen) of Chicago, IL; his grandson Benjamin Marciante; and his brother Graham Collins of Deltona, FL.
